Narikala” Walking Route
Tourist Route “Narikala”  will be  really an unforgettable route for everybody who embarks on it. This route covers Tbilisi historical districts.
The castle Narikala, Upper and Lower Bethlehem churches (XVIII century), Kldisubani St. George church, (XVIII century), Armenian –Gregorian church Surf-Gevork  ( XVIII century).
Christian churches, the Muslim mosque (XIX), Jewish Synagogue and the fire worshipers ancient worship building “Ateshga“  stand  Side by side each other. Tbilisi narrow streets and suphur bath houses will leave nobody  careless about these  places.

The cultural – tourist 1,5 km long route begins  at the entrance of the botanical garden, goes along the Narikala fortress slopes and ends at the Betlehem church. The most attractive Tbilisi sights are seen from the ruins of the feudal castle.

On the path the special binoculars, benches and information boards  are  installed. At night Narikala route is unusually attractive offering cute Tbilisi views at night to the tourists. People mounting on Narikala find themselves in an original Tbilisian entourage. The fine panorama offers  the unique sights having 15 century history.
